What's it like to stay in a motel?
Motels often have free parking, and many also feature an outdoor pool. Often one or two stories tall, motel properties usually have outdoor access to guestrooms from the parking lot. Motels began in the 1920s as convenient lodging for the weary traveler taking a road trip along America’s major roadways.

What's the weather like in Shiono Onsen?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so here’s some data about year-round temperatures in Shiono Onsen to help you plan yours: The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 75°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. The rainiest months in Shiono Onsen are July, June, September, and October,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
